Dielectric , modulus and impedance analysis of lead-free ceramics Ba 0 . 8 La 0 . 133 Ti 1 − x Sn x O 3 ( x = 0 . 15 and 0 . 2 )

| Abstract | Titanate barium (BaTiO3)-type oxide ceramics Ba0.8La0.133Ti1−xSnxO3 (BLTS) (here x = 0.15 and 0.2) have been synthesized by the standard solid-state reaction method. Preliminary room temperature X-ray study confirms the formation of single-phase compounds in a rhombohedral crystal system. The electrical properties of BLTS were studied using the ac impedance spectroscopy technique over a wide range of temperature (120–320 K) in the frequency range of 40 Hz to 10 MHz. The presence of a single arc in the complex modulus spectrum at different temperatures confirms the single-phase character of the BLTS compounds. |
